The Importance of Official Study Materials
The naturalization test is conducted by the U.S. Citizenship and EinbüRgerungstest ÜBung Immigration Services (USCIS). It includes 2 main elements: the English test and the civics test. While the English portion assesses a candidate's capability to read, compose, and speak the language, the civics part requires a deep understanding of U.S. history and government.
While numerous unofficial guides exist on the marketplace, the main USCIS research study book remains the gold requirement. It is the only resource that ensures the info lines up precisely with the concerns asked by migration officers during the interview.

Purchasing the book is only the primary step. Success needs a structured research study plan. The following lists lay out the core requirements and preparation ideas.
List for the Civics TestResearch study the 100 Questions: Applicants must be prepared to respond to 10 concerns from the list of 100.Pass Mark: A minimum of 6 out of 10 concerns should be answered correctly.Understand Context: Use the "Quick Civics Lessons" book to comprehend why a response is appropriate, rather than simply memorizing it.Stay Updated: Be aware of changes in chosen authorities (e.g., existing President, Vice President, and State Governors).Checklist for the English TestSpeaking: Practice answering concerns about the N-400 application.Reading: Be able to check out one out of three sentences properly.Writing: Be able to write one out of three sentences properly.Official Vocabulary: Use the vocabulary notes offered in the back of the main book to practice writing noises and common words.Tips for Effective StudyingDaily Consistency: Dedicate 15 to 30 minutes each day to checking out one chapter of the book.Flashcards: Use the details in the book to create flashcards. This is a tested approach for discovering names, dates, and historical occasions.Group Study: Many applicants find it useful to study with household members or pals who are likewise going through the process.Usage Audio Supplements: USCIS provides audio versions of the 100 concerns. Exists a new variation for 2024?
While USCIS sometimes updates the test style (such as the 2020 variation which was briefly implemented and after that withdrawn), the 2008 variation of the civics test stays the existing standard for most of applicants. Prospects should always ensure their research study materials match the variation of the test they will be required to take.
